Flexible Layouts

Understanding Flexible Layouts in Responsive Design

What is Flexible Layouts?
Flexible layouts are designs that adjust and change based on the size of the screen they are being viewed on. This means that whether you are using a phone, tablet, or computer, the content will fit perfectly on the screen without losing quality or making it hard to read.

Why Are Flexible Layouts Important?

Flexible layouts are crucial for creating a good user experience. When a website is flexible, it can easily adapt to different devices. This is important because more people are using their mobile devices to browse the internet. A site that looks good on all screen sizes keeps users happy and encourages them to stay longer.

Key Features of Flexible Layouts

  1. Adaptable Grids: Flexible layouts use grids that expand or contract. These grids can change their size to fit any screen. This means that content flows smoothly and looks organized at any size.

  2. Percentage-Based Widths: Instead of using set sizes, flexible layouts often use percentages. This allows elements like images and text to resize automatically, making sure everything stays in view.

  3. Responsive Images: Images in flexible layouts can also resize. This ensures that graphics look clear and attractively scaled on both small and large screens, improving the visual appeal of the site.

  4. User-Friendly Navigation: A flexible layout often includes navigation menus that adjust for smaller screens. This makes it easier for users to find what they need, whether they are using a smartphone or a computer.

Benefits of Using Flexible Layouts

  • Improved User Experience: Because content adjusts to the screen size, users find it easier to read and navigate.
  • Better Search Engine Ranking: Search engines, like Google, prefer sites that are mobile-friendly. Using flexible layouts can help boost your site's ranking in search results.
  • Cost-Effective: Flexible layouts save time and money in the long run. Instead of creating separate websites for different devices, one flexible design works for all.

Why Assess a Candidate’s Flexible Layouts Skills?

Assessing a candidate's skills in flexible layouts is important for several reasons.

First, flexible layouts are a key part of modern web design. Websites need to look great on all devices, from smartphones to tablets to desktops. If a candidate knows how to create flexible layouts, they can help make sure your website is user-friendly and visually appealing no matter what device people use.

Second, strong skills in flexible layouts can improve your site's search engine ranking. Search engines like Google reward websites that are mobile-friendly. A candidate who understands flexible layouts can help your business attract more visitors, leading to higher sales and engagement.

Lastly, assessing this skill can save your team time and effort. Candidates who are proficient in flexible layouts can quickly produce responsive designs. This means you won’t have to spend extra time and resources making changes to fit different screens.

In short, finding a candidate with solid skills in flexible layouts will benefit your business by improving user experience, boosting search engine visibility, and enhancing team efficiency.

How to Assess Candidates on Flexible Layouts

Assessing candidates on their flexible layouts skills is vital to ensure they can create responsive designs that work well on all devices. Here are a couple of effective test types to evaluate their abilities.

Practical Design Test

One effective way to assess a candidate's flexible layouts skill is through a practical design test. In this test, candidates can be asked to create a responsive web layout based on a provided design brief. This allows you to see how they apply their knowledge of adaptable grids, percentage-based widths, and responsive images in a real-world scenario. Candidates can use design tools or code directly in a browser to demonstrate their skills.

Code Review

Another valuable assessment method is a code review. You can ask candidates to submit examples of their previous work that involve flexible layouts. By reviewing the HTML and CSS used in their designs, you can gauge their understanding of responsive design principles. Look for elements like fluid grids and media queries, which are essential for creating effective flexible layouts.

Utilizing Alooba's assessment platform, you can easily create and administer these tests to find candidates who excel in flexible layouts. By choosing the right assessments, you ensure that the candidate you hire will enhance your website's usability and performance.

Topics and Subtopics in Flexible Layouts

Understanding flexible layouts involves several key topics and subtopics. Below is an outline that breaks down these concepts to help you grasp the essential elements of flexible design.

1. Introduction to Flexible Layouts

  • Definition of Flexible Layouts
  • Importance in Responsive Design

2. Grid Systems

  • Definition of Grid Systems
  • Types of Grid Systems (e.g., fluid, fixed, and responsive grids)
  • How to Implement Grid Layouts

3. Fluid Layouts

  • Definition of Fluid Layouts
  • Usage of Percentage-Based Widths
  • Advantages of Fluid Layouts

4. Media Queries

  • What are Media Queries?
  • How to Use Media Queries for Responsive Design
  • Breakpoints and Their Importance

5. Responsive Images

  • Importance of Responsive Images
  • Techniques for Making Images Flexible
  • Using CSS for Image Responsiveness

6. Navigation Design

  • Best Practices for Responsive Navigation
  • Mobile-Friendly Navigation Menus
  • Drop-Down and Hamburger Menu Designs

7. Testing and Optimization

  • Tools and Techniques for Testing Flexible Layouts
  • Common Issues in Responsive Design
  • Strategies for Optimization

8. Best Practices

  • Accessibility Considerations in Flexible Layouts
  • Design Tips for Improved User Experience
  • Maintaining Consistency Across Devices

By exploring these topics and subtopics, you can gain a comprehensive understanding of flexible layouts and how to implement them effectively in web design. This knowledge is critical for creating websites that provide a seamless experience on all devices.

How Flexible Layouts Are Used

Flexible layouts are a vital component of modern web design, enabling websites to adapt seamlessly to various screen sizes and devices. Below are several key ways in which flexible layouts are utilized:

1. Enhancing User Experience

Flexible layouts improve user experience by ensuring that content is easily accessible and visually appealing on any device. When users visit a website, they expect it to look good and function well, whether they are on a smartphone, tablet, or desktop computer. A responsive design that utilizes flexible layouts minimizes the need for zooming or scrolling, making navigation straightforward and enjoyable.

2. Supporting Mobile-First Design

With the increasing use of mobile devices for browsing, flexible layouts support mobile-first design strategies. Designers often start by creating a layout for small screens and gradually adjust it for larger devices. This approach ensures that websites prioritize mobile usability, leading to higher engagement and lower bounce rates.

3. Boosting Search Engine Optimization (SEO)

Search engines like Google favor websites that are mobile-friendly. By using flexible layouts, businesses can enhance their SEO performance. A responsive site that adapts to different devices is more likely to appear higher in search engine results, attracting more organic traffic. This is crucial for gaining visibility in a crowded online marketplace.

4. Streamlining Development Processes

Flexible layouts streamline the web development process by reducing the need for separate designs for various devices. Instead of creating multiple versions of a website, developers can focus on a single responsive design. This efficiency saves time and resources, allowing for faster deployment and updates.

5. Catering to Diverse Audiences

Websites often have audiences using a wide range of devices with different screen sizes. Flexible layouts allow businesses to cater to this diversity effectively. By ensuring that all users have a consistent and favorable experience, companies can broaden their reach and connect with more potential customers.

In summary, flexible layouts are used to enhance user experience, support mobile-first design, boost SEO, streamline development, and cater to diverse audiences. By implementing flexible layouts, businesses can create responsive websites that meet the needs of today’s dynamic online users.

Roles That Require Good Flexible Layouts Skills

Flexible layouts skills are essential for various roles in web development and design. Below are some key positions that benefit from expertise in this area:

1. Web Designer

A Web Designer is responsible for creating the visual elements of a website. They must understand flexible layouts to ensure the site looks good and functions well on all devices, providing an optimal user experience.

2. Front-End Developer

A Front-End Developer focuses on the client-side of applications. This role requires strong skills in flexible layouts to build responsive interfaces that effectively adapt to different screen sizes and resolutions.

3. UX/UI Designer

A UX/UI Designer works on the overall look and feel of a website or application. Good flexible layouts skills are crucial for this role, as they help create intuitive and user-friendly designs that work across all devices.

4. Full-Stack Developer

A Full-Stack Developer has expertise in both front-end and back-end development. They need a solid understanding of flexible layouts to ensure seamless integration and functionality between different components of a website or web application.

5. Mobile App Developer

A Mobile App Developer designs and builds applications for mobile devices. Familiarity with flexible layouts is important for ensuring that apps have a responsive design that works on various screen sizes and orientations.

By mastering flexible layouts, professionals in these roles can create effective, user-friendly designs that enhance the overall web experience.

Associated Roles

UI/UX Designer

A UI/UX Designer is a creative professional who specializes in enhancing user satisfaction by improving the usability, accessibility, and pleasure provided in the interaction between the user and the product. They employ a variety of design principles and methodologies to create engaging and effective user experiences.

Find the Right Talent for Flexible Layouts Today!

Streamline Your Hiring Process with Alooba

Assessing candidates for flexible layouts is crucial to ensuring your web design meets modern standards. With Alooba, you can easily create tailored assessments that measure expertise in responsive design. Save time and find the best talent that can enhance your website's user experience and SEO performance.

Our Customers Say

Play
Quote
We get a high flow of applicants, which leads to potentially longer lead times, causing delays in the pipelines which can lead to missing out on good candidates. Alooba supports both speed and quality. The speed to return to candidates gives us a competitive advantage. Alooba provides a higher level of confidence in the people coming through the pipeline with less time spent interviewing unqualified candidates.

Scott Crowe, Canva (Lead Recruiter - Data)